China Longjiang Chemical Expects to Produce Qualified Products of Phenol and Acetone by the End of November
This year, Daqing City in Heilongjiang Province, China, regards the construction of major projects as a "power source" to promote high-quality development of the real economy.
China Longjiang Chemical's polycarbonate joint project was handed over on August 30.At present, various pre-production work such as feeding and operation are being stepped up. After nearly 21 months of hard work, this project is expected to produce qualified phenol acetone products before the end of this month and qualified bisphenol A products in the middle of next month.
Jun Deng, deputy general manager of Longjiang Chemical Co., Ltd., said that after nearly 21 months of hard work, the first-phase project will be able to produce qualified phenol and acetone products by the end of this month. After the first phase of the project is put into operation, it is expected to achieve an output value of more than 3.2 billion yuan and a profit and tax of more than 600 million yuan in 2024.
The second phase of the project is already being actively planned and promoted and is expected to start smoothly next year. The second phase of the project is expected to be put into production by the end of 2026. After both phases of the project are put into operation, it is expected to achieve an output value of more than 6 billion yuan, and profits and taxes of more than 1 billion yuan.
This project uses propylene and toluene as raw materials to create a full industrial chain of "phenol/acetone-bisphenol A-polycarbonate". The downstream polycarbonate can be widely used in electronics, automobiles, medical equipment and other fields. The total investment in the project is approximately 7 billion yuan. The first phase plans to invest 3.5 billion yuan to build three units with an annual output of 200,000 tons of pure benzene, 350,000 tons of phenol acetone, and 200,000 tons of bisphenol A.
